Immigrants from Eastern Europe vs Immigrants from Turkey Single Father Households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 469,396,556 people shows a moderate neg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Eastern Europe and percentage of single father households in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.447 and weighted average of 2.0%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 221,918,090 people shows a poor neg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Turkey and percentage of single father households in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.125 and weighted average of 2.0%, a difference of 0.23%.
